DATA_SET_DESCRIPTION Data Set Overview:This data set contains the Level 2 CONSERT data referred toGROUND Mission Phase measurements performed by the lab bench.Data:The data output by the bench is quite raw as it is composed of pure signalwithout any housekeeping or acknowledgments. They refer to CODMAC Level 2.The different experiment configurations are describedin the related document[RO-OCN-TR-3801, RO-OCN-TR-3802 and RO-OCN-TR-3805].The calibration data taken from the CONSERT bench is used for Science signalcalibration. It is composed of raw in-phase (I) and in quadrature (Q)components which are not accumulated and not compressed by the matchedfilter.Processing:Only CODMAC Level 2 data are present in this data set.Coordinate System:In calibration, there is no relevant coordinate system in use.

ABSTRACT_TEXT This archive contains edited calibration data (CODMAC level 2) that refers to laboratory and AIT/AIV GROUND measurements of the lab bench of the CONSERT instrument. During this GROUND phase, CONSERT instrument has performed numerous technical and calibration tests. For archiving purposes, only calibration tests during which CONSERT orbiter flight model (FMO) or CONSERT lander spare model (FSL) is operated in synchronization with the lab bench (Ping-Pong mode) have been included. The data archived in this dataset conform to the Planetary Data System (PDS) Standards, Version 3.6.
